    There's a couple of dodgy ones on there, and probably Okocha was one that could have been, but him and Folan signing changed everyone's belief in the promotion season that we were going to be serious contenders at the end of the season, even if no one really expected it to finish as well as it did.

    Barmby has to be on the list, not only for what he achieved on the pitch, but the fact that we'd signed a Premier League regular for the last ten odd years with plenty of England caps and he was dropping all the way down to League 1 to play for us. Again, his signing helped to transform the belief amongst the fans that we were on the up that year I think.
